Mardonius exaggerates grossly. Only small sections of the Indians (iii. 98, 101) and of the African Aethiopians (iii. 97) with the Amyrgian Sacae (cf. ch. 64. 2; iii. 93. 3) and the Eastern Ethiopians (iii. 94, vii. 70) were subjects of the Persian empire.
